During an interview with Deadline in June 2021, Channing Tatum expressed his gratitude for being considered by Zoë Kravitz for her directorial debut film, “Pussy Island”.

In August 2021, there were whispers of a budding romance between Tatum and Kravitz, which they seemed to validate with a charming bike ride through New York City. A source shared with TopMob News that beyond friendship, there was something deeper between Channing and Zoe. They were spending a great deal of time together and enjoying each other’s company. Their bond transcended the level of close friends or co-stars, as their relationship had evolved into something more meaningful.

Initially, they arrived at the 2021 Met Gala separately on the red carpet, but later, they were snapped leaving the event jointly. Interestingly, Channing Tatum posted a picture with Zoë Kravitz on his Instagram Story from the post-event party.

On their initial Halloween celebration, they opted for a shared costume inspired by the characters portrayed by Robert De Niro and Jodie Foster in the movie “Taxi Driver”.
